怎么用云服务器搭建个人博客网站呢

使用云服务器搭建个人博客网站需选购合适的云服务器,安装Web服务器软件如Apache或Nginx,配置数据库如MySQL,部署博客系统如WordPress,并完成域名解析及SSL证书安装。

搭建个人博客网站可以是一个有趣且富有成就感的过程,而云服务器则为我们提供了一种灵活、可扩展的解决方案,以下是如何使用云服务器搭建个人博客网站的详细步骤。

选择云服务提供商

怎么用云服务器搭建个人博客网站呢

选择一个可靠的云服务提供商,市面上有很多选项,如Amazon Web Services (AWS), Google Cloud Platform (GCP), Microsoft Azure, Alibaba Cloud等,比较它们的价格、性能和服务,然后根据个人需求和预算做出选择。

购买并设置云服务器

1、购买实例:在所选的云服务提供商平台上购买一个云服务器实例(亦称作虚拟机)。

2、选择操作系统:常见的操作系统有Ubuntu, CentOS, Windows Server等,大多数博客平台对Linux系统有更好的支持。

3、配置防火墙和安全组:确保正确配置了防火墙规则和安全组以允许HTTP和HTTPS流量。

安装必要的软件

1、Web服务器:安装如Apache或Nginx这样的Web服务器软件,它们将处理进入网站的请求。

2、数据库:如果博客平台需要,安装数据库软件,比如MySQL或PostgreSQL。

3、PHP/Python/Ruby等:某些博客平台可能需要服务器端脚本语言的支持。

4、FTP服务:为了方便文件传输,可以安装FTP服务如vsftpd。

安装博客平台

有多种博客平台可供选择,如WordPress, Ghost, Jekyll等,按照官方文档指引进行安装和配置。

WordPress

1、使用wgetcurl下载最新版本的WordPress。

2、解压下载的文件到Web服务器的根目录。

怎么用云服务器搭建个人博客网站呢

3、创建数据库并记下数据库名称、用户名和密码。

4、运行WordPress安装脚本并填写相关信息。

5、完成安装后访问域名,应该能看到WordPress的设置页面。

Jekyll

1、安装Ruby环境。

2、使用gem命令安装Jekyll。

3、克隆或创建一个新的Jekyll网站仓库。

4、构建网站静态文件,并将其放置在Web服务器的根目录。

配置域名和SSL

1、注册域名:购买一个个性化域名,并将DNS解析设置到你云服务器的IP地址。

2、启用SSL:通过Let's Encrypt获取免费的SSL证书,并在服务器上配置HTTPS。

优化和备份

1、缓存:设置Web服务器和PHP/Python等的缓存来提高性能。

2、备份:定期备份数据库和网站文件到云存储或其他位置。

3、监控:设置系统监控以确保网站的稳定运行。

怎么用云服务器搭建个人博客网站呢

维护和更新

1、定期更新博客平台和插件,确保安全性和最新功能。

2、审核评论和提交,防止垃圾信息。

至此,你的个人博客网站已经建立完毕,可以通过互联网访问了。

相关问题与解答

Q1: 我是否需要了解编程知识来搭建个人博客?

A1: 基本的计算机操作和网络知识是有帮助的,但不一定需要深入的编程技能,许多博客平台提供用户友好的界面和插件系统,使得非技术用户也能轻松管理自己的博客。

Q2: 我应该选择哪个博客平台?

A2: 这取决于你的需求和技术熟悉度,WordPress功能强大且插件众多,适合大多数用户;Ghost简洁现代,适合个人写作;而Jekyll则适合喜欢静态网站和自定义设计的开发者。

Q3: 我的数据安全如何保障?

A3: 定期备份数据至安全的存储服务,并确保使用强密码和SSL加密来保护网站和用户数据,同时保持软件更新来修复可能的安全漏洞。

Q4: 我的网站流量增加后,应该如何升级我的云服务器?

A4: 大多数云服务提供商允许你调整实例大小(垂直扩展),或者增加更多实例(水平扩展),你可以根据流量和使用情况调整资源,确保网站响应迅速。

原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/472013.html

Like (0)
Donate 微信扫一扫 微信扫一扫
K-seo的头像K-seoSEO优化员
Previous 2024-05-09 00:56
Next 2024-05-09 01:01

相关推荐

  • 国外云主机_管理云主机

    管理国外云主机涉及监控资源使用、更新安全补丁、备份数据和配置防火墙等。使用云服务提供的管理工具或第三方软件,可以简化维护流程,确保主机稳定运行并及时响应安全威胁。

    2024-07-07
    084
  • 云服务器的数据被删除还能恢复吗?

    云服务器的数据一旦被删除,是否能恢复取决于云服务提供商的备份策略和数据恢复服务。如果及时联系提供商并采取措施,有可能恢复部分或全部数据。

    技术教程 2024-04-15
    0176
  • 如何在云服务器上实施渗透测试并利用合约查询数据?

    利用云服务器进行渗透测试是一种安全实践,旨在发现系统漏洞。通过模拟攻击者行为,可以评估安全防护的有效性,并采取预防措施。使用合约查询数据是区块链应用中的一种常见操作,它允许用户根据智能合约的规则检索信息,这有助于提高透明度和安全性。

    2024-08-01
    067
  • 云服务器有实体主机吗

    云服务器没有实体主机,它是通过虚拟化技术在物理服务器上创建多个虚拟机实例,用户可以根据需求租用这些实例。

    2024-05-03
    0144
  • 如何有效访问云服务器中的数据库?

    访问云服务器中的数据库,可以通过多种方式实现,以下将详细介绍如何通过不同的方法连接云服务器上的MySQL和SQL Server数据库:一、准备工作1、购买云服务器:在阿里云或腾讯云等平台购买合适的服务器实例,选择操作系统(如CentOS、Ubuntu等)和配置,2、安装MySQL:登录到服务器后,下载并安装My……

    2024-11-06
    06
  • 购买云服务器需要看哪些参数

    购买云服务器时,主要考虑CPU核心数、内存大小、硬盘容量、带宽、流量、数据中心地区、操作系统、存储类型如SSD或HDD、以及价格和服务商的可靠性等因素。

    2024-04-30
    0157

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

免备案 高防CDN 无视CC/DDOS攻击 限时秒杀,10元即可体验  (专业解决各类攻击)>>点击进入